A London Street Scene (1930)

Barnett Freedman

oil on canvas

Salford Museum and Art Gallery

A London Street Scene (1930)

Details

Classification:

Painting

Materials:

Oil, Canvas

Physical Object Description:

Street scene in London.

Dimensions:

68.5 x 183 cm

Accession Number:

1933-46

Credit:

Presented by the Contemporary Art Society, 1933

Scheme:

Gift

Ownership history:

Gifted by Sir Edward Marsh (1872-1933) to the Contemporary Art Society, 1931; presented to Salford Museum and Art Gallery, 1933
